4. Improve Your Credit Score

Mortgage rates have doubled over the past few years, but you don’t need to pay that rate. There’s an easy way to improve your chances of getting approved for a loan and lowering the mortgage rate significantly. Just work on your credit score to cut down on the cost of homeownership.

If you’re sitting at the higher end of 600s, try to get it over 700. If you’re already in the 700s, try to reach 760 or higher. A higher credit score often qualifies you for a lower mortgage rate. If you’re able to lower the rate by just 0.1%, you can save tens of thousands of dollars in the long run. Here are some of the things you can do to improve your credit score:

● Don’t delay bill payments

● Lower your credit utilisation ratio compared to the total credit limit

● Don’t open new cards or loan accounts

● Check your credit report regularly and report discrepancies to the credit bureaus

A great credit score helps you portray yourself as a less risky option to lenders and unlocks the path to owning an Okanagan property for sale.
